LOS ANGELES (Reuters) - Following are the top 10 films at the North American box office for the three-day weekend beginning on November 28, led by new release "Four Christmases," according to studio estimates compiled on Sunday by Reuters.

Five-day figures for new movies over the U.S. Thanksgiving holiday are reflected in the "Totals To Date" chart.

1 (*) Four Christmases ................... $31.7 million

2 (3) Bolt ............................... $26.6 million

3 (1) Twilight ........................... $26.4 million

4 (2) Quantum of Solace .................. $19.5 million

5 (*) Australia .......................... $14.8 million

6 (4) Madagascar: Escape 2 Africa ........ $14.5 million

7 (*) Transporter 3 ...................... $12.3 million

8 (5) Role Models ........................ $ 5.3 million

9 (8) The Boy in the Striped Pajamas ..... $ 1.7 million

10 (*) Milk ............................... $ 1.4 million

NOTE: Last weekend's ranking in parentheses. * = new release.
